Output ddd73394faf30a0556fd97bc4aeeba805c85ee85384330fa295ab038dcf87439:150

value
129845
script pubkey
OP_0 OP_PUSHBYTES_20 6f5eef8a43fb6b23d9dd27978dfbba4947a231a7
address
bc1qda0wlzjrld4j8kway7tcm7a6f9r6yvd8tl546z
transaction
ddd73394faf30a0556fd97bc4aeeba805c85ee85384330fa295ab038dcf87439
confirmations
203009
spent
true